BREAKING: UK final PMI higher than expectations!
BREAKING: Eurozone PPI in line with expectations.
BREAKING: European Services PMIs Slightly Above Expectations in October. EURUSD slightly up!
BREAKING: France's industrial production exceeds expectations! EURUSD slightly up!